KEMETs Automotive Grade High Voltage surface mount MLCCs in C0G dielectric feature a 125°C maximum operating temperature and are considered stable. The Electronics Industries Alliance (EIA) characterizes C0G dielectric as a Class I material. Components of this classification are temperature compensating and are suited for resonant circuit applications or those where Q and stability of capacitance characteristics are required. C0G exhibits no change in capacitance with respect to time and voltage and boasts a negligible change in capacitance with reference to ambient temperature.
